引言
随着科技的不断发展,大数据和人工智能技术已经深入到各个领域,其中包括体育。大模型作为一种先进的机器学习技术,正逐渐改变着体育数据分析的方式,为运动员、教练和团队提供更加精准的决策支持。本文将深入探讨大模型在体育数据分析中的应用,以及它如何推动竞技体育的革新。
大模型简介
大模型通常指的是拥有海量参数的深度学习模型,它们能够处理复杂的非线性关系,并在多个任务上表现出色。在体育数据分析领域,大模型可以应用于图像识别、视频分析、数据预测等方面。
大模型在体育数据分析中的应用
1. 图像识别
在体育比赛中,图像识别技术可以用于实时分析运动员的动作、技术细节和比赛环境。例如,通过分析运动员的动作,可以评估其技术动作的准确性、力量和协调性。
# 伪代码示例:使用卷积神经网络(CNN)进行运动员动作识别
def train_action_recognition_model(data):
model = create_cnn_model()
model.fit(data['images'], data['actions'])
return model
# 训练模型
action_recognition_model = train_action_recognition_model(training_data)
2. 视频分析
视频分析技术可以用于对比赛录像进行详细分析,包括运动员的速度、耐力、战术执行等。通过分析这些数据,教练和运动员可以识别出提升表现的机会。
# 伪代码示例:使用循环神经网络(RNN)进行视频数据预测
def train_video_analysis_model(data):
model = create_rnn_model()
model.fit(data['videos'], data['performance_metrics'])
return model
# 训练模型
video_analysis_model = train_video_analysis_model(training_data)
3. 数据预测
大模型在数据预测方面的应用可以帮助预测比赛结果、运动员表现和伤病风险。通过分析历史数据和实时数据,可以为决策者提供有价值的洞察。
# 伪代码示例:使用随机森林模型进行比赛结果预测
def train_prediction_model(data):
model = create_random_forest_model()
model.fit(data['historical_data'], data['results'])
return model
# 训练模型
prediction_model = train_prediction_model(historical_data)
大模型的优势
1. 高度自动化
大模型可以自动从大量数据中学习,减少了人工干预的需求,提高了分析的效率和准确性。
2. 全面性
大模型能够处理多种类型的数据,包括文本、图像和视频,从而提供更全面的视角。
3. 精准性
通过不断学习和优化,大模型可以提供更精准的预测和分析结果。
挑战与未来展望
尽管大模型在体育数据分析中具有巨大的潜力,但仍然面临一些挑战:
1. 数据质量
高质量的数据是构建有效大模型的基础。在体育领域,数据质量可能受到多种因素的影响,如数据缺失、不一致等。
2. 解释性
大模型的决策过程往往不够透明,这可能导致对其预测结果的可信度产生质疑。
3. 伦理问题
大模型的应用可能会引发隐私、公平性和透明度等伦理问题。
未来,随着技术的不断进步和问题的解决,大模型在体育数据分析中的应用将更加广泛和深入。通过与其他技术的结合,如增强现实和虚拟现实,大模型将为运动员和教练提供更加沉浸式和个性化的训练和比赛体验。